There are various techniques and methods that can help you control your climax, such as the start-stop technique, deep breathing exercises, and mindfulness practices. These techniques can be adapted to suit different preferences and needs, making them accessible to a wide range of people. For example, some individuals may find that physical exercise or stress reduction activities help them regain control over their arousal.
Getting started with controlling your climax can be as simple as practicing self-awareness and relaxation techniques. You can begin by taking a few minutes each day to focus on your breathing and body sensations, allowing yourself to become more attuned to your physical and emotional state. This increased awareness can help you recognize the signs of impending climax and take steps to slow down or redirect your energy.
